Smoked Turkey Legs On Camp Chef Pellet Grill

2 Jumbo Turkey legs. Brined over night. Rubbed with olive oil and seasoned with Code3 AP, Traeger’s Pork & Poultry Rub and a little Boars Night Out White Lightning Double Garlic Butter. Smoked between 250-300 until internal temp of 165-170. Sprayed every hour with equal parts of water, Worcestershire & soy or liquid amino. These massive legs took about 4 hours.
